Cherry Wood said...
Stayed 25th August 2020
The standard of cleanliness in the room was totally unacceptable and should have been 100% in these times. Upon checking in, there was urine in the toilet, an empty beer can and cigarette ends on the balcony. I complained, the duty manager gave the bathroom a once over, but the balcony was left and the room needed a general good clean. There was black mould on the bathroom ceiling, the balcony door didn't lock and we didn't sleep under the bed covers, there was a hair and crumbs in the single bed. The first night we had no lights as they went off and we had to wait for maintenance to come in the next day to sort it. The restaurant food was OK but the staff were clearly pushed.
